Transaction df6468e8d26ccd7f02853e9832ff2903b95b178ebe1ee5993f530f8efa687835
1 Input
1 Output
-
df6468e8d26ccd7f02853e9832ff2903b95b178ebe1ee5993f530f8efa687835:0
- value
- 145861893
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ff1156c8916d0c7cb3d4b4e49da14031e396b0b2
- address
- bc1qlug4djy3d5x8ev75knjfmg2qx83edv9j20lh87